软件工程师职业素质及道德规范【荐】.pptVIP

软件工程师职业素质及道德规范【荐】.ppt

  1. 1、本文档共16页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
软件工程师职业素质及道德规范【荐】.ppt

第7章 软件工程师职业素质及道德规范 本章导读 为了发展中华民族的软件产业,必须提高软件企业和软件人员的职业素质及道德规范。 本章从多个不同角度,系统而全面地分析了中国软件公司的集体素质和个体素质,从业务素质和道德规范两个方面,对国内软件工程师提出了基本要求,最后公布了软件工程职业道德规范和实践要求的国际标准。 本章涉及的几个问题,无论是软件开发人员或软件管理人员,只要你联系实际,仔细捉摸,都会从中获得莫大的启迪。 表7-1列出了读者在本章学习中要了解、理解和关注的主要内容。 本章对读者的要求 一位中国软件工程师的感言 1.印度软件公司开发软件的特点是什么? 2.看看自己适不适合现在学习软件工程 ? 3.中国软件企业存在的主要问题是什么? 4.中国软件企业的主要差距是什么? 5.中国软件企业存在差距的原因是什么? 软件工程师业务素质 (1) 首先必须喜欢软件,热爱软件事业,对软件开发、管理或维护工作特别感兴趣; (2) 至少要熟练地掌握两种编程语言,能写出规范化的源程序; (3) 熟悉数据结构和数据库,能设计出问题求解的数据结构或数据库,即数据建模; (4) 养成了良好的文档书写习惯,真正理解软件是“知识、程序、数据和文档”的集合,即:软件 = 知识+程序+数据+文档; (5) 在软件工程技术上与时俱进,努力跟踪并掌握有关的软件开发工具及环境,如当前的.Net开发环境和J2EE开发环境,以及Power Designer和Rational Rose等CASE工具; (6) 在行业领域知识上与时俱进,努力跟踪并掌握所在行业领域知识,不断适应客户的需求变化; (7) 在技术上或管理上不断地总结经验、吸取教训,做到每年都有所长进; (8) 在业务工作中提倡与遵守团队精神,反对个人英雄主义。 软件工程师道德规范 (1) 首先必须做一位遵纪守法的公民,在企业内外不惹事; (2) 做事认真负责,一丝不苟,每一条语句都经过周密思考; (3) 再忙再累也不会走捷径,对自己拿出手的东西绝不马虎; (4) 不会给合作方造成麻烦,良心大大地好; (5) 看得见看不见都会做到更好,自我控制已经形成习惯、成为风格; (6) 永远在学新东西,永远觉得自己还不行,让自己不断进步; (7) 善了吸取教训,勇于承担责任; (8) 最后才是聪明才智,也就是说不能太蠢太笨。 软件工程师职业实践的基本要求 (1)自觉遵守公民道德规范标准和中国软件行业基本公约; (2) 讲诚信, 坚决反对各种弄虚作假现象,不承接自己能力尚难以胜任的任务,对已经承诺的事,要保证做到,对情况变化和有特殊原因,实在难以做到时,应及早向当事人报告说明; (3) 讲团结、讲合作,有良好的团队协作精神,善于沟通和交流,在业务讨论上,积极坦率地发表自己的观点和意见,对理解不清楚和有疑问的地方,决不放过; (4) 有良好的知识产权保护观念,自觉抵制各种违反知识产权保护的行为,不购买和使用盗版软件,不参与侵犯知识产权的活动,在自己开发的产品中,不拷贝复用未取得使用许可的他方内容; (5) 树立正确的技能观,努力提高自己的技能,为社会和人民造福,绝不利用自己的技能去从事危害公众利益的活动, 包括构造虚假信息和不良内容、制造电脑病毒、参与盗版活动、非法解密存取、黑客行为和攻击网站等,提倡健康的网络道德准则和交流活动,对利用自己的电脑知识,积极参与社会科学普及活和应用推广活动,应大力鼓励和提倡; 软件工程师职业实践的基本要求 (6) 认真履行签定的合同和协议规定,有良好的工作责任性,不能以追求个人利益为目的, 不随意向他人泄露工作和客户机密; (7) 软件业是一个不断变化和不断创新的行业,面对飞速发展的技术,能自觉跟踪技术发展动态,积极参与各种技术交流、技术培训和继续教育活动,不断改进和提高自己的技能,自觉参与项目管理和软件过程改进活动; (8) 努力提高自己的技术和职业道德素质,力争做到与国际接轨,提交的软件和文档资料,技术上能符合国际和国家的有关标准; (9)有良好的编码能力,至少精通一门编程语言; (10)信息是以数据为中心的,因此与数据库的交互在所有软件中都是必不可少的,了解数据库操作和编程是软件工程师需要具备的基本素质之一; (11)程序世界的主导语言是英文,作为软件工程师,具有一定的英语基础对于提升自身的学习和工作能力极有帮助。 软件工程职业实践的国际标准 原则1 公众 软件工程师应当以公众利益为目标,特别是在适当的情况下软件工程师应当: 1.01 对他们的工作承担完全的责任; 1.02 用公益目标节制软件工程师、雇主、客户和用户的利益; 1.03 批准软件,应在确信软件是安全的、符合规格说明的、经过合适测试的、不会降低生活品质、影响隐私权或有害环境的条件之下,一切

文档评论(0)

wulf +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档